Former U.S. President Donald Trump has made his Super Bowl LXI prediction, backing the Kansas City Chiefs to win against the Philadelphia Eagles this Sunday in New Orleans.
Trump Chooses Mahomes and the Chiefs
In an interview with Fox News, Trump explained his reasoning for supporting Patrick Mahomes and the Chiefs:
"When a quarterback wins as much as he has, I have to go with Kansas City. I have to go with Kansas City."
Despite picking the Chiefs, Trump acknowledged the strength of their rivals, stating: "Philadelphia has a fantastic team, so it's going to be a great game."
A Historic Super Bowl Attendance
Trump is expected to attend the game in New Orleans, making history as the first sitting U.S. president to be present at a Super Bowl in its 59-year history.
Earlier this week, during a White House press conference, Trump had already hinted at his admiration for Mahomes, saying:
"There’s a certain quarterback who seems to be a pretty solid winner."
When asked about Trump’s comments, Mahomes responded:
"It’s great to hear that he has watched how I play football and respects my style of play."
